Urban redevelopment and sustainability are two key priorities for cities looking to combat climate change and enhance quality of life for residents. In Zurich, Switzerland, an innovative approach combining vehicle-to-grid (V2G) technology with urban redevelopment projects is revolutionizing the way energy is managed and utilized in the city. V2G technology enables electric vehicles (EVs) to not only draw power from the grid but also to return excess energy back to the grid when needed. This two-way flow of electricity offers numerous benefits, including increased grid stability, optimized energy usage, and potential cost savings for consumers. Zurich, known for its commitment to sustainability and innovative solutions, has embraced V2G technology as part of its urban redevelopment efforts. By integrating EV charging infrastructure with smart grid systems in newly developed and redeveloped urban areas, the city is creating a more efficient and sustainable energy ecosystem. One of the key advantages of V2G technology in urban redevelopment is its ability to support renewable energy integration. As Zurich aims to increase its renewable energy capacity, V2G-enabled EVs can serve as mobile energy storage units, helping to balance supply and demand on the grid and maximize the use of solar and wind power. Furthermore, V2G technology plays a vital role in reducing carbon emissions and improving air quality in urban areas. By promoting the adoption of EVs and incentivizing V2G participation, Zurich is paving the way for a cleaner and healthier urban environment for its residents. In addition to its environmental benefits, V2G technology also has economic advantages for both consumers and utilities. Through V2G-enabled EVs, consumers can earn revenue by selling excess energy back to the grid, while utilities can better manage peak demand and reduce infrastructure costs. Overall, the integration of V2G technology in urban redevelopment projects in Zurich showcases the city's forward-thinking approach to sustainability and energy innovation. By leveraging the power of EVs to support the grid and drive progress towards a carbon-neutral future, Zurich is setting a positive example for other cities around the world to follow. As urban areas continue to grow and evolve, the combination of V2G technology with urban redevelopment efforts presents a promising solution for balancing energy needs, reducing emissions, and creating more sustainable and livable cities. Zurich's experience demonstrates that by embracing smart solutions and prioritizing sustainable development, cities can drive positive change and lead the way towards a greener future.
